ITANAGAR, May 27: With power supply still remaining disrupted in the districts of East Kameng, West Kameng, Pakke Kessang and Tawang due to torrential downpour, Chief Engineer, Power-West Zone & In-charge Transmission, Bar Takum while requesting the consumers of these districts to bear with the inconvenience has assured that efforts are on to restore power supply at the earliest.
“Work is in full swing in many areas and identification of damaged poles is still going on,” Takum said, adding that the departmental staff are working day and night to restore power supply. CE divulged that on Wednesday engineers have located a damaged pole between Nicipu and Sadar area in East Kameng and restoration work is on.
Linemen led by the engineers from Bhalukpong, Rupa, East Kameng have been pressed into service to identify and repair the faulty lines, CE informed. “Although on Tuesday our workers identified and restored a damaged tower (Number 156) and repaired it at around 12 pm, power supply could last only for a minute,” he added.
Requesting the consumers to bear with the inconveniences, he said that despite incessant rains, professionals are working without breaks risking their lives. Meanwhile, Rahung Hydel Power in Bomdila (85KW) and Dirang Hydropower (20kW ) are providing electricity for emergency services in the township for one hour on a daily basis.
During the past week, East Kameng, West Kameng including parts of Pakke Kesang and Tawang have received heavy rainfall which has thrown the larger part of the power supply infrastructure in these districts completely out of gear.
